Incoming Anchorage Archbishop Paul Etienne flew from Wyoming and landed in Anchorage on Nov. 3 to begin preparation for his Nov. 9 installation as the new Archbishop of Anchorage.

He began his first full day in Anchorage by celebrating an 8:30 a.m. Mass with members of his staff at the Pastoral Center. On Nov. 8, a vespers prayer service will take place at Holy Family Cathedral, beginning at 7 p.m. to pray for the archbishop. On Nov. 9, at 2 p.m., he will be formally installed as the archbishop. The installation Mass will be live streamed at www.CatholicAnchor.org.
